radio fuse blown?

radio went out and is not working? IT's an 04 tl with no nav. I checked the fuses inside. I'm sure its the # 5 fuse but it's not blown. Even checked under the hood. Am I over looking something. I have the radio code, but it's not even coming on for me to enter it. any advice guys? It's got to be a fuse.

you found the actual radio fuse??- probably on passenger side footwell area
chk owner manual for sure

those fuses are tricksters and may not look blown- grab one of the spare fuses of same rating and test that way- I have been fooled by them before

Did you do any work on the car recently?
